Better Know A Crafter: Zareen Kapadia

Zareen is one of our lovely craft night ladies, and a super fantastic seamstress. I love the wrap skirts she's been making lately!

Zareen Kapadia


1) Tell us about yourself. What makes you want to craft?
I do DNA testing in a clinical lab. The fabrics at Fancy Tiger inspire me to sew. Mostly I make gifts (baby clothes, quilts, dolls) but this skirt is just for myself.

2) Tell us about the skirt you made.
This Joel Dewberry Deer Valley print was begging to be a skirt. I followed a McCalls wraparound skirt pattern and embellished it with a tagua nut button.


3) How did you learn how to sew?
I was taught to sew by my stepfather when I was 8 years old on an old treadle foot Singer. I have been sewing ever since.

4) What is your favorite animal?
I admire elephants and also delight in sea creatures.
